2016693b0c feat(llm): per-provider unsupported parameter filtering (#749, #728) (#809)
Add declarative `unsupported_params` field to provider definitions in
providers.json. Parameters listed are stripped from requests before
sending, preventing 400 errors from providers that reject them (e.g.
gpt-5 family and kimi-k2.5 rejecting custom temperature values).

- Add `unsupported_params` to ProviderDefinition and RegistryProviderConfig
- Propagate from registry through config resolution
- Generic strip helpers handle temperature, max_tokens, stop_sequences
- Apply filtering in RigAdapter and AnthropicOAuthProvider
- Mark openai and tinfoil providers as unsupporting temperature
- Update openai default model to gpt-5-mini

1440ec7422 fix(ci): secrets can't be used in step if conditions [skip-regression-check] (#787)
GitHub Actions step-level `if:` doesn't have access to `secrets` context.
Replace `if: secrets.X != ''` with `continue-on-error: true` and let
the Set token step handle the fallback.
